VARNADO v. GENTILLY MEDICAL CLINIC FOR WOMEN

No. 98-CA-0264.

728 So.2d 479 (1998)

Meranda VARNADO v. GENTILLY MEDICAL CLINIC FOR WOMEN.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, Fourth Circuit.

December 23, 1998.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Nicolas Estiverne, Nicolas Estiverne & Associates, New Orleans, for Plaintiff/Appellant.

Andrew A. Lemeshewsky, Jr., New Orleans, for Defendants/Appellees.

Before KLEES, ARMSTRONG, PLOTKIN, WALTZER and McKAY, JJ.


McKAY, Judge.

In this case we are called upon to decide whether the trial court erred when it found that this action had been abandoned under La. C.C.P. art. 561 and dismissed it. We conclude that the trial court did not err and affirm its judgment.
